Concealed In contrast to standard hinges that extend from the window frame, concealed hinges aren't a problem with the lines of the sash. They are integrated into frames, making them the ideal option for modern and minimalist styles. They also ensure that the rebate seal isn't damaged, thereby increasing the strength of the window and its thermal insulation. In addition, concealed hinges are less likely to be damaged by dust or weather. These hinges are made from high-grade ferritic stainless steel and have been rated to 20,000 cycles. They are also simple to install, meaning you can complete the task quickly and efficiently. Installing them is easy and doesn't require any special tools. Based on your requirements you can select from side opening or top opening hinges. You can use these hinges to replace your existing uPVC windows or to create new ones. These hinges come in a variety of sizes and stacking heights unlike traditional uPVC hinges that are only available in a handful of sizes. They also meet BS EN 1670 Grade 4 requirements, which means that they are indestructible to dirt and weather. Furthermore, they can support an amount of up 25kg. A hinge that is concealed is more easy to maintain than a conventional exposed one because the hinge's components are hidden from view. The hinges' covers are prone to changing color and becoming brittle with time. Additionally, the gaps between the covers and the veneer can trap dust, which makes it difficult to keep them clean. Hidden hinges are also quieter than exposed hinges. They do not vibrate because they are in the sash's rebate. Additionally they can be used with a variety of window materials like timber and aluminium. They are also suitable for larger windows, like casement windows. Security When it comes to home security, the quality of the window hinge is an important factor to take into. A strengthened and reinforced window hinge made of uPVC can be more effective in deterring burglars than the standard hinges. Independent testing bodies evaluate several uPVC door and window hinges for security. The most secure hinges are tested according to BS EN 1935, which defines the requirements for hinges that are designed to allow windows or doors to move in a single direction (closed/opened) and not rotate more than 30 millimeters from their initial position. The strength of a uPVC hinge is also vital and a lot of them are constructed from materials such as aluminium or steel to offer exceptional levels of durability and resistance against attempts to force entry. Advanced uPVC hings are treated with corrosion-resistant coatings and materials to enhance their ability resist damage from external weather conditions. One of the best ways to ensure that your double glazed replacement windows are secure and secure is to install them with a multi-point locking mechanism. This will prevent your windows from being damaged and also keep intruders out of your home. There are a myriad of uPVC hinges designed for security and can be used in a multi-point locking system. However there are other options that are available. These hinges may have anti-bump or anti-drilling features that can shield your windows from common attempts to break into. Installing security brackets on your uPVC hinges is a great option to enhance the security. These are tough interlocking brackets that reinforce the hinges of the window frame and make it more difficult for burglars to break into your windows. Another option is to put your uPVC windows with fire escape hinges or egress hinges. These hinges are narrower and feature an easy-clean facility, making cleaning the outside of windows much easier. They can be fitted to windows with sash, and come in a variety of sizes that suit the majority of profiles.
